Buying Guide
What material suits you best? Leather offers a classic look and durability, while fabric options can be lighter and more affordable. Consider how much you need to carry: a single passport, several cards, a boarding pass, and perhaps a few bills. RFID blocking is essential for many travelers, but verify the level of protection (13.56 MHz compatibility is common). If you’re a frequent flyer who travels with family, a multi-pocket option like TOPBAG can simplify management. For brand-conscious shoppers, Tory Burch provides designer styling, while VEEVIGEN and PASCACOO offer strong RFID features at approachable prices. Always check the number of card slots, the presence of a zipper or secure clasp, and how easy it is to access your documents in crowded spaces.
